How much does it cost to rent an apartment in The Plains?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
The Plains Studio Apartments | $2,010 | $1,100 | $4,010 |
The Plains 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,409 | $1,150 | $6,164 |
The Plains 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,935 | $1,250 | $8,978 |
The Plains 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,698 | $2,160 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about The Plains
What is the current price range for One Bedroom The Plains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in The Plains ranges from $1,150 to $6,164 with an average monthly rent of $2,409.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in The Plains c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in The Plains range from $1,250 to $8,978.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,935.
How expensive are The Plains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 18 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in The Plains on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,160 to $10,294 - averaging $3,698 for the location.
